As part of our ongoing site investigation and characterization work, we have been drilling several monitoring wells in the Mt. Eyre neighborhood. Additional monitoring wells will be installed at two additional locations in the Mt. Eyre neighborhood on Walker Road. This work is scheduled to begin as early as Monday, September 8, 2025.
During this work, sound walls will be installed around each drilling site as appropriate to mitigate noise. For this phase of work, no road closures are anticipated.
Residents will observe drilling equipment and support vehicles in the neighborhood during this work, and drilling equipment may remain on site overnight. Drilling activities will be conducted between the hours of 9 a.m. and 5 p.m., Monday through Saturday. Equipment setup and site cleanup may occur outside of this time frame, as approved by Upper Makefield Township.
These monitoring wells will be used to evaluate groundwater quality as part of our continued site investigation and characterization work. The work is being completed under the oversight of the Pennsylvania Department of Environmental Protection in accordance with the Act 2 regulations, as part of our response to the pipeline release.
